Warley Wasps on the radio! - March 17, 2021



Great to hear Graham Harrington, GB player, World University Games 2017 participant and Warley Wasps stalwart providing his thoughts live on Black Country Radio about all things water polo.

As an antidote to the usual football chat on James Vukmirovic’s sports show, Graham talked about Warley Wasps’s success in the Midlands, getting back in the pool and of course the prospect of 2022 Commonwealth Games coming to the West Midlands.

Welcome to our monthly England Water Polo News - March 1, 2021



Our route back!

This month we at least have more reason to be optimistic that a return to water polo training is round the corner, albeit not quite as close as many of us hoped.  The timetable announced by the government is set out in the table below.

The timetable is subject to the caveat that the number of Covid-19 infections remains under control.  Assuming this is the case outdoor swimming pools and lidos should open from 29 March.
